在oracle数据库中,要求两个字段的和要怎么写sql语句
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了在oracle数据库中,要求两个字段的和要怎么写sql语句相关的知识,希望对你有一定的参考价值。
在oracle数据库中,要求两个字段的和可以用sql语句(前提是两个字段都是数字型):
SELECT num1+num2 AS num FROM table_name;
其中num1、num2是要求和的两个字段,num是新命名的和字段,table_name是要查询的表名。
扩展资料:
Oracle Database,又名Oracle RDBMS,或简称Oracle。是甲骨文公司的一款关系数据库管理系统。它是在数据库领域一直处于领先地位的产品。
可以说Oracle数据库系统是目前世界上流行的关系数据库管理系统,系统可移植性好、使用方便、功能强,适用于各类大、中、小、微机环境。它是一种高效率、可靠性好的、适应高吞吐量的数据库方案。
1,如果都是数字类型的直接把这两个字段相加
select
a+b as ab
from S ;
或者你的意思是 select sum(a+b) from S;
2,如果是不同的字段类型就不能求和了,但是可以使用“||”或者CONCAT()函数
2.1 select a||b from S;
2.2 select concat(a,b) from S;
参考资料来源:百度百科-Oracle数据库
参考技术A在oracle数据库中,要求两个字段的和可以用sql语句(前提是两个字段都是数字型):
SELECT num1+num2 AS num FROM table_name;
其中num1、num2是要求和的两个字段,num是新命名的和字段,table_name是要查询的表名。
扩展资料
oracle常用sql语句:
select * from dba_users; --数据库用户信息
select * from dba_roles; --角色信息
select * from dba_segments; --表段信息
select * from dba_extents; --数据区信息
select * from dba_objects; --数据库对象信息
select * from dba_lobs; --lob数据信息
select * from dba_tablespaces; --数据库表空间信息
select * from dba_data_files; --数据文件设置信息
select * from dba_temp_files; --临时数据文件信息
参考技术B 1.如果都是数字类型的直接把这两个字段相加select
a+b as ab
from S ;
或者你的意思是 select sum(a+b) from S;
2.如果是不同的字段类型就不能求和了,但是可以使用“||”或者CONCAT()函数
2.1 select a||b from S;
2.2 select concat(a,b) from S; 参考技术C 直接相加就可以了吧
select a.a+a.b
from A; 参考技术D 比如:要查询emp中的其中几列的comm和
select sum(comm) from emp where EMPNO in(7499,7521)
ORACLE中如果两个字段如果能关联的语句怎么写
通过两张表关联,where条件用等值连接就行了,这是最基本的sql关联语句呢,亲,举例:selecta.col1,a.col2,b.col1,b.col2fromtable1a,table2bwherea.colname=b.colname 参考技术A select 语句1UNION ALL
select 语句2
这样来连接各个查询的结果
以上是关于在oracle数据库中,要求两个字段的和要怎么写sql语句的主要内容,如果未能解决你的问题,请参考以下文章
oracle 11g中怎么将查询指定的数据不在指定的字段方法
oracle字段类型NUMBER(38,3),括号中两个数字分别表示啥?